But let's not forget about the rise of streaming services. This is where things get really interesting. Services like ESPN+, Paramount+, Peacock, and Amazon Prime Video are all getting in on the football games tonight action. ESPN+ offers a variety of college games and other sports content, while Paramount+ often streams NFL games that are broadcast on CBS. Peacock, NBC's streaming service, carries Sunday Night Football, and Amazon Prime Video has exclusive rights to Thursday Night Football. Streaming services give you a ton of flexibility. You can watch on your TV using a smart TV or a streaming device like Roku or Apple TV, or you can watch on your phone, tablet, or computer. This means you can catch the game wherever you have an internet connection. Finally, remember to check the specific broadcast details for the game you want to watch. Some games are exclusive to certain streaming services or networks, so it's worth double-checking before kickoff. Websites like 506sports.com are fantastic resources for finding detailed broadcast maps for NFL games, showing you which games are airing in your local area. This can save you the frustration of tuning in to the wrong channel or realizing you need a specific streaming subscription at the last minute.
